Inclusion of Kazakhstan in the work permit system in South Korea

02 October, 2024

As part of a working visit to South Korea, the Vice Minister of Labor and Social Protection of the Population of the Republic of Kazakhstan, Askarbek Yertayev, held a meeting with representatives of the Ministry of Employment and Labor of the Republic of Korea. During the talks, the parties discussed the inclusion of Kazakhstan in the Employment Permit System (hereinafter referred to as EPS) in South Korea.

“Kazakhstan is taking a number of comprehensive measures aimed at further improving the legal framework for protecting the labor and social rights of migrants. In particular, a multidisciplinary center for professional and language training for citizens of the Republic of Kazakhstan wishing to work in the Republic of Korea is being created in Almaty,” Askarbek Yertayev informed.
He also reported that a number of social and production facilities have been identified that are ready to conduct testing, medical examinations, and advanced training in technical professions.

“Together with the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Republic of Kazakhstan, issues are being worked out to strengthen measures aimed at preventing illegal migration and creating conditions for expanding legal labor activity,” the Vice Minister added.

Following the negotiations, representatives of the Ministry of Employment and Labor of the Republic of Korea once again confirmed their intention to include Kazakhstan in the EPS system, which will provide Kazakhstani citizens with the opportunity to legally work in South Korea under concluded labor contracts.

At the end of the meeting, the parties noted the importance of deepening cooperation between Kazakhstan and South Korea in the field of labor migration, which will improve conditions for Kazakhstani citizens seeking employment abroad, as well as improve the level of their professional training.
